* [Re V2]:Patch "Bluetooth: btusb: Add 0bda:b85b for Fn-Link RTL8852BE" has been added to the 5.10-stable tree [not found] ` <tencent_27789A681229CCB77BE3E186@qq.com> @ 2023-11-24 14:59 ` 关文涛 2023-11-24 15:12 ` Greg KH 0 siblings, 1 reply; 7+ messages in thread From: 关文涛 @ 2023-11-24 14:59 UTC (permalink / raw) To: Sasha Levin, stable-commits; +Cc: stable, marcel, luiz.dentz, hildawu Hello Levin: Apologize for my HTML format past.I discovered that the backport patches also have dependency in 5.10 lts tree: [1]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=75742ffc3630203e95844c72c7144f507e2a557d [2]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=40e2e7f1bf0301d1ed7437b10d9e1c92cb51bf81 [3]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=9c45bb363e26e86ebaf20f6d2009bedf19fc0d39 [4]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=3a292cb18132cb7af3a146613f1c9a47ef6f8463 [5]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=1a2a2e34569cf85cad743ee8095d07c3cba5473b and update version 2 depend patches link: [1] RTL8852AE: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=0d484db60fc0c5f8848939a61004c6fa01fad61a [2] RTL8852BE: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=18e8055c88142d8f6e23ebdc38c126ec37844e5d [3] RTL8852CE: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=8b1d66b50437b65ef109f32270bd936ca5437a83 [4] FW: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=cf0d9a705d81a0f581865cefe0880f29589dd06f 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------- I would like to express my gratitude for you efforts,and I want to provide you with the backport tip when kernel <=5.10 : the RTL8852{A,B,C} BT chip series depend patches in that patch [1](v5.11) and load new firmware need that patch [2](v5.4). Apologize for my pool English. link: [1] https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=0d484db60fc0c5f8848939a61004c6fa01fad61a [2] https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=cf0d9a705d81a0f581865cefe0880f29589dd06f ^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Re V2]:Patch "Bluetooth: btusb: Add 0bda:b85b for Fn-Link RTL8852BE" has been added to the 5.10-stable tree 2023-11-24 14:59 ` [Re V2]:Patch "Bluetooth: btusb: Add 0bda:b85b for Fn-Link RTL8852BE" has been added to the 5.10-stable tree 关文涛 @ 2023-11-24 15:12 ` Greg KH 2023-11-24 16:56 ` 关文涛 0 siblings, 1 reply; 7+ messages in thread From: Greg KH @ 2023-11-24 15:12 UTC (permalink / raw) To: 关文涛 Cc: Sasha Levin, stable-commits, stable, marcel, luiz.dentz, hildawu On Fri, Nov 24, 2023 at 02:59:15PM +0000, 关文涛 wrote: > Hello Levin: > > Apologize for my HTML format past.I discovered that the backport patches also have dependency in 5.10 lts tree: > > [1]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=75742ffc3630203e95844c72c7144f507e2a557d > [2]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=40e2e7f1bf0301d1ed7437b10d9e1c92cb51bf81 > [3]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=9c45bb363e26e86ebaf20f6d2009bedf19fc0d39 > [4]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=3a292cb18132cb7af3a146613f1c9a47ef6f8463 > [5]https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=1a2a2e34569cf85cad743ee8095d07c3cba5473b > > and update version 2 depend patches link: > > [1] RTL8852AE: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=0d484db60fc0c5f8848939a61004c6fa01fad61a > [2] RTL8852BE: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=18e8055c88142d8f6e23ebdc38c126ec37844e5d > [3] RTL8852CE: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=8b1d66b50437b65ef109f32270bd936ca5437a83 > [4] FW: https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/?id=cf0d9a705d81a0f581865cefe0880f29589dd06f I'm sorry, but I do not understand what we need to do here. What git ids need to go to what tree and in what order? > I would like to express my gratitude for you efforts,and I want to provide you with the backport tip when kernel <=5.10 : > the RTL8852{A,B,C} BT chip series depend patches in that patch [1](v5.11) and load new firmware need that patch [2](v5.4). > Apologize for my pool English. Your english is great, but I really don't understand what is to be done here. Can you just list the ids in the order which you want them applied and to what tree(s)? thanks, greg k-h ^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Re V2]:Patch "Bluetooth: btusb: Add 0bda:b85b for Fn-Link RTL8852BE" has been added to the 5.10-stable tree 2023-11-24 15:12 ` Greg KH @ 2023-11-24 16:56 ` 关文涛 2023-11-30 13:30 ` Greg KH 0 siblings, 1 reply; 7+ messages in thread From: 关文涛 @ 2023-11-24 16:56 UTC (permalink / raw) To: Greg KH; +Cc: stable, Sasha Levin, hildawu Hello Greg: I thiink that the most clean thing that backport to v6.1 lts tree, because it has "Add support for RTL8852B" commit link [1]: In v5.15 lts tree,it miss patch [1]. In v5.10 lts tree,it miss "Add support for RTL8852A"[2] so "git am" command not simply work,but without the patch RTL8852B works. In v5.4 lts tree,it miss more ids,need more efforts to do.If someone need,need to backport their own pid/vid pairs. In v4.19 lts tree,it miss patch [3],so firmware download will failed. For backport patches[4][5][6][7][8], they miss "Add support for RTL8852C"[9] in v5.15 and v5.10 lts tree. Otherwise,I also found that in v5.10 lts tree path file: root/drivers/bluetooth/btusb.c MT7922 id [10] [11] add without its dependency [12] [13] AX210 id [14] add without its dependency [15] Sorry for maybe I miss some device id.How do other people think the situation where some BT ids backports are done without dependencies? Best regards guan wentao link: RTL8852: [1]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v6.1&id=18e8055c88142d8f6e23ebdc38c126ec37844e5d [2]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?id=0d484db60fc0c5f8848939a61004c6fa01fad61a [3]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=linux-5.4.y&id=cf0d9a705d81a0f581865cefe0880f29589dd06f RTL8852C: [4]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=75742ffc3630203e95844c72c7144f507e2a557d [5]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=40e2e7f1bf0301d1ed7437b10d9e1c92cb51bf81 [6]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=9c45bb363e26e86ebaf20f6d2009bedf19fc0d39 [7]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=3a292cb18132cb7af3a146613f1c9a47ef6f8463 [8]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=v5.10.201&id=1a2a2e34569cf85cad743ee8095d07c3cba5473b [9]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?id=8b1d66b50437b65ef109f32270bd936ca5437a83 MT7922: [10]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=linux-5.10.y&id=f19add5c77601599f52dd7e3554e58da5d25367c [11]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=linux-5.10.y&id=c20021ce945f38e8597551687fdb115bfca7ae86 [12]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=linux-5.12.y&id=fc342c4dc408754f50f19dc832152fbb4b73f1e6 [13]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=linux-5.15.y&id=3f502147ffc3f9973471adbf16697569f626ee5a AX210: [14] https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?h=linux-5.10.y&id=875e16759005e3bdaa84eb2741281f37ba35b886 [15] https://patchwork.kernel.org/project/bluetooth/list/?series=387475&state=%2A&archive=both ^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Re V2]:Patch "Bluetooth: btusb: Add 0bda:b85b for Fn-Link RTL8852BE" has been added to the 5.10-stable tree 2023-11-24 16:56 ` 关文涛 @ 2023-11-30 13:30 ` Greg KH 2023-11-30 14:17 ` 关文涛 0 siblings, 1 reply; 7+ messages in thread From: Greg KH @ 2023-11-30 13:30 UTC (permalink / raw) To: 关文涛; +Cc: stable, Sasha Levin, hildawu On Sat, Nov 25, 2023 at 12:56:34AM +0800, 关文涛 wrote: > Hello Greg: > I thiink that the most clean thing that backport to v6.1 lts tree, > because it has "Add support for RTL8852B" commit link [1]: > > In v5.15 lts tree,it miss patch [1]. > In v5.10 lts tree,it miss "Add support for RTL8852A"[2] so "git am" > command not simply work,but without the patch RTL8852B works. > In v5.4 lts tree,it miss more ids,need more efforts to do.If someone > need,need to backport their own pid/vid pairs. > In v4.19 lts tree,it miss patch [3],so firmware download will failed. > > For backport patches[4][5][6][7][8], > they miss "Add support for RTL8852C"[9] in v5.15 and v5.10 lts tree. > Otherwise,I also found that in v5.10 lts tree path file: > root/drivers/bluetooth/btusb.c > MT7922 id [10] [11] add without its dependency [12] [13] > AX210 id [14] add without its dependency [15] > Sorry for maybe I miss some device id.How do other people think the > situation where some BT ids backports are done without dependencies? Can you provide just a list of git ids, without footnotes or links, as that is a pain to attempt to cut-paste from? Better yet, can you provide backported patch series of the needed commits like is sent all the time to the stable mailing list (so you can see examples) and we can take them that way? That way you get credit for the backporting and testing as you will have added your signed-off-by to the commits. thanks, greg k-h ^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Re V2]:Patch "Bluetooth: btusb: Add 0bda:b85b for Fn-Link RTL8852BE" has been added to the 5.10-stable tree 2023-11-30 13:30 ` Greg KH @ 2023-11-30 14:17 ` 关文涛 2023-11-30 14:26 ` Greg KH 0 siblings, 1 reply; 7+ messages in thread From: 关文涛 @ 2023-11-30 14:17 UTC (permalink / raw) To: Greg KH; +Cc: stable, Sasha Levin, hildawu > Can you provide just a list of git ids, without footnotes or links, as > that is a pain to attempt to cut-paste from? Sure, v5.15 git id list: 18e8055c88142d8f6e23ebdc38c126ec37844e5d 8b1d66b50437b65ef109f32270bd936ca5437a83 v5.10 git id list: 0d484db60fc0c5f8848939a61004c6fa01fad61a 18e8055c88142d8f6e23ebdc38c126ec37844e5d 8b1d66b50437b65ef109f32270bd936ca5437a83 v5.4 git id list: 0d484db60fc0c5f8848939a61004c6fa01fad61a 18e8055c88142d8f6e23ebdc38c126ec37844e5d 8b1d66b50437b65ef109f32270bd936ca5437a83 Best regards guan wentao ^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Re V2]:Patch "Bluetooth: btusb: Add 0bda:b85b for Fn-Link RTL8852BE" has been added to the 5.10-stable tree 2023-11-30 14:17 ` 关文涛 @ 2023-11-30 14:26 ` Greg KH 2023-11-30 14:45 ` 关文涛 0 siblings, 1 reply; 7+ messages in thread From: Greg KH @ 2023-11-30 14:26 UTC (permalink / raw) To: 关文涛; +Cc: stable, Sasha Levin, hildawu On Thu, Nov 30, 2023 at 10:17:16PM +0800, 关文涛 wrote: > > Can you provide just a list of git ids, without footnotes or links, as > > that is a pain to attempt to cut-paste from? > Sure, > > v5.15 git id list: > 18e8055c88142d8f6e23ebdc38c126ec37844e5d > 8b1d66b50437b65ef109f32270bd936ca5437a83 > > v5.10 git id list: > 0d484db60fc0c5f8848939a61004c6fa01fad61a > 18e8055c88142d8f6e23ebdc38c126ec37844e5d > 8b1d66b50437b65ef109f32270bd936ca5437a83 > > v5.4 git id list: > 0d484db60fc0c5f8848939a61004c6fa01fad61a > 18e8055c88142d8f6e23ebdc38c126ec37844e5d > 8b1d66b50437b65ef109f32270bd936ca5437a83 These do not apply cleanly to those kernel trees, can you please provide a working set of backported patches that are fixed up and tested for these branches? thanks, greg k-h ^ permalink raw reply [flat|nested] 7+ messages in thread
* Re: [Re V2]:Patch "Bluetooth: btusb: Add 0bda:b85b for Fn-Link RTL8852BE" has been added to the 5.10-stable tree 2023-11-30 14:26 ` Greg KH @ 2023-11-30 14:45 ` 关文涛 0 siblings, 0 replies; 7+ messages in thread From: 关文涛 @ 2023-11-30 14:45 UTC (permalink / raw) To: Greg KH; +Cc: stable, Sasha Levin, hildawu > These do not apply cleanly to those kernel trees, can you please provide > a working set of backported patches that are fixed up and tested for > these branches? Thanks for your kindly reminder. I will resend patches set to mailing lists after testing. Best Regards guan wentao ^ permalink raw reply [flat|nested] 7+ messages in thread
end of thread, other threads:[~2023-11-30 14:45 UTC | newest]
Thread overview: 7+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
[not found] <20231124043548.86153-1-sashal@kernel.org>
[not found] ` <tencent_27789A681229CCB77BE3E186@qq.com>
2023-11-24 14:59 ` [Re V2]:Patch "Bluetooth: btusb: Add 0bda:b85b for Fn-Link RTL8852BE" has been added to the 5.10-stable tree 关文涛
2023-11-24 15:12 ` Greg KH
2023-11-24 16:56 ` 关文涛
2023-11-30 13:30 ` Greg KH
2023-11-30 14:17 ` 关文涛
2023-11-30 14:26 ` Greg KH
2023-11-30 14:45 ` 关文涛
This is a public inbox, see mirroring instructions for how to clone and mirror all data and code used for this inbox